Acting Portsmouth police Chief David Mara will soon be changing jobs and taking on the role of the Governor’s Advisor on Addiction and Behavioral Health.

That role, also known as the “drug czar,” is currently occupied by James Vara, who is moving back over to the state attorney general’s office, where he will serve as chief of staff to Attorney General Gordon MacDonald.

“James Vara has been an invaluable asset in New Hampshire’s continued efforts to address the substance misuse and mental health crises in our state and I am grateful for his friendship as well as his outstanding service as a member of my staff,” Gov. Chris Sununu said in a statement.

Sununu also praised Mara, who he said has “served with distinction on the front lines of law enforcement” and knows the impact of the drug crisis. Mara previously served as Manchester police chief.

Vara’s appointment to the state attorney general’s office must first be reviewed and approved by the New Hampshire Executive Council, and is scheduled to be addressed at its June 7 meeting.
